WWE Reported To Have Extended WWE Staff Furloughs Another Month

WWE made a mass wave of releases and furloughs to employees both on screen and backstage back in April due to the COVID-19 pandemic. It now looks as though those furloughed employees will have to wait a while longer before being brought back into the company for work.

In the latest issue of the Wrestling Observer Newsletter, Dave Meltzer reports that there are a number of WWE Staff Members who were furloughed that have had their furloughs extended through August 28th, 2020.

WWE made the decision to release or furlough numerous WWE Producers and Talent back in April of this year. Since then, WWE has brought back a couple of the people who would involved in the April 15th cuts. Drake Maverick was released, but brought back to NXT. As well as backstage Producer Pat Buck, who was also released but recently brought back and featured in an angle on Monday Night Raw with Nia Jax. Others however, have not had the same luck. Former ECW, WCW, and WWE Superstar and most recently a backstage producer/agent Lance Storm has mentioned on twitter that he is a free agent for the first time since 1994.

It was originally believed that WWE would be bringing furloughed employees back at the beginning of August. But, as cases of COVID-19 continue to increase, and sanctions and restrictions once again tighten up from state to state, the decision was made to extend those within WWE who had been furloughed for at least another month.
